College of Education, University of Al-Qadisiyah discussed a master dissertation on the appearance and molecularness of the efflux pump operon in Klebsiella Pneumoniae isolated from different clinical cases by the postgraduate student, Mrs. Areej Abed Al-Redha Makki. The dissertation highlighted isolating and diagnosing of bacteria via culture and biochemical methods, as well as using the diagnostic gene 16SrRNA, studying the resistance pattern, determining the dominant pattern, determining the minimum inhibitory concentration and investigating the mechanism of the efflux pump type AcrABR in the isolates under study besides determining the succession of nitrogenous bases for the pump genes, so that the effluent was drawn and the genetic tree was drawn and the phenotypic detection of the effluent pump was done using the wooden wheel method via using ethidium bromide dye. The dissertation reviewed that 18 out of 36 effluent pump isolates possessed the phenotypic detection via using (polymerase chain reaction).
